The culture of engagement rings in Russia has been formed relatively recently, but it has already become an important part of the preparation for marriage. Taisiya Iznova, SOKOLOV's category director, told Izvestia on April 10 about how customer preferences and key trends have changed.

"The main purpose of an ideal engagement ring is to create a wow effect. In America, where this culture is centuries-old, it is considered good form to spend three salaries of the groom on the ring. There are no such established norms in Russia, but the expectation of something more than just decoration is definitely present," the expert noted.

According to her, if earlier buyers had to find a compromise between the size of the stone and its characteristics, today the situation has changed significantly. The development of the segment of jewelry with grown diamonds has become one of the key factors in the transformation of the market. Such stones allow you to choose a larger and more visually spectacular product without significantly increasing the cost, while demonstrating a comparable radiance and play of light with natural diamonds. As a result, rings with stones weighing about one carat have become more accessible to a wide audience.

Iznova stressed that the changes affected not only the price segment, but also aesthetic preferences. Over the past year, the focus has noticeably shifted towards non-standard cuts. Previously, the classic round shape remained the main choice, and the "princess" or "sash" served as an alternative, but today "oval", "pear" and "marquis" come to the fore. This interest is connected both with global trends formed through public engagements, and with the active dissemination of fashion solutions through social networks. As a result, the demand for non-classical forms is growing rapidly.

The expert also noted that the engagement ring is increasingly becoming the starting point when choosing wedding jewelry. Many brides tend to wear it daily, so couples choose wedding rings so that they harmonize with each other. Classic solutions remain the most in demand: smooth rings with a width of 2 to 5 mm with a traditional or comfortable fit. At the same time, diamond-edged models are in second place in popularity, which give the decoration a more expressive appearance.

Special attention is paid to the combination of rings in a pair. Often, more restrained options are chosen for the groom — smooth or with a diamond face, while for the bride, preference is given to models with a diamond track. Among modern solutions, the so-called rail fastening is gaining popularity, in which stones are fixed between two metal edges, which makes the decoration more stable and visually neat.

According to Iznova, the key factor in choosing jewelry remains the scenario of their use. If rings are planned to be worn daily, most buyers prefer concise and versatile models that fit seamlessly into their everyday look. At the same time, the proportion of those who choose more expressive options that combine symbolic significance and decorative function is growing. In particular, diamond track rings are gaining popularity, which are perceived as a universal piece of jewelry, suitable not only for a special occasion, but also for daily wear.

On March 18, Ekaterina Fomina, stylist of the 585 Golden brand, named the most practical options for wedding rings. According to her, the most popular material for jewelry is gold, and this is no coincidence. Gold alloys are quite durable, resistant to corrosion and tolerate daily wear well. White gold is highly wear-resistant and goes well with stones. It is important to remember that such jewelry is usually covered with rhodium, a protective layer that should be periodically updated in a jewelry workshop.
